"Ilex burfordii Nana," commonly known as Dwarf Burford Holly, is a popular evergreen shrub that belongs to the holly family (Aquifoliaceae). It is a hybrid holly resulting from a cross between Ilex cornuta and Ilex latifolia. Dwarf Burford Holly is valued for its glossy, dark green foliage, attractive berries, compact growth, and versatility in landscaping.
Here are some key features and information about Ilex burfordii nana (Dwarf Burford Holly):
-
Foliage: The leaves are typically dark green, glossy, and have a distinctive holly shape with spiny margins. The foliage provides year-round interest to the landscape.
-
Berries:This particular holly is self-pollinating, meaning that these shrubs will produce berries without a male shrub being present.
-
Size:Dwarf Burford Holly is known for its compact, dense growth habit. It can be pruned to maintain a more formal appearance or left to grow naturally.
-
Form: It typically has a pyramidal or rounded shape, making it suitable for use as a specimen plant, hedge, or foundation planting.
-
Sun and Soil Requirements: Burford Holly prefers full sun to partial shade. It is adaptable to a variety of soil types but thrives in well-draining soil.
-
Hardiness: It is generally hardy in USDA Hardiness Zones 7 to 9. It can tolerate a range of climates but may benefit from protection in harsh winter conditions.
-
Landscaping Use: Dwarf Burford Holly is versatile and can be used in various landscaping settings. It's often used as a hedge, screen, foundation planting, or as a standalone specimen in gardens and parks.
-
Pruning: Pruning can be done to maintain the desired shape and size. Regular pruning helps encourage bushier growth and enhances the overall appearance of the plant.
-
Disease Resistance: Burford Holly is generally resistant to many pests and diseases, making it a relatively low-maintenance choice for landscapes.
When incorporating Dwarf Burford Holly into your landscape, consider its mature size, sun exposure, and soil conditions.
